Our humidity & condensation mold control process in East Islip, NY
Inspect
We check humidity levels room by room and identify where condensation is forming and why.
Contain
We isolate any area with active mold growth before cleaning to avoid spreading spores.
Remove
Mold on window frames, drywall, or ductwork is cleaned or removed depending on the surface and extent.
Dry
We address the humidity source itself, since surface cleaning alone won't stop condensation from recurring.
Verify
We check that humidity levels and affected surfaces are back within a normal range.

Why does mold keep coming back on my window sill?
If condensation keeps forming, wiping the mold away is only a temporary fix. The underlying humidity or insulation issue needs to be addressed.
Is condensation mold less serious than mold from a flood?
It's typically smaller in scope, but it can still spread if left unaddressed and the underlying humidity issue is not corrected.
